As nouns, slenderness is a hypernym of threadiness; that is, slenderness is a word with a broader meaning than threadiness:
  • threadiness: The state or quality of consisting of or bearing fibers or filaments.
  • slenderness: relatively small dimension through an object as opposed to its length or width
Other hypernyms of threadiness include tenuity, thinness.
